Data Governance Specialist (f/m) 80-100% # Luzern / hybrid with flexible start date permanent Data creates the greatest added value when it is used responsibly. Whether sound business decisions, innovative data products, or the successful use of AI: they all build on clear responsibilities, common standards, and effective data governance. As a Data Governance Specialist, together with the Chief Data Officer and the Center of Excellence Data & AI, you will further develop the company-wide data governance of CSS and create the prerequisites for a responsible and value-adding use of data. You ensure that governance is lived in everyday work. Would you like to help shape the future of data usage at one of the leading health insurance companies in Switzerland? Then we look forward to getting to know you. And because balance must also be right, flexible working hours, a generous home office share, and a culture at eye level await you. This is what your everyday life looks like ## • At the heart: You continuously develop the company-wide Data Management and Governance Framework and anchor it in the organization together with the specialist departments. • You develop governance principles, roles, guidelines, and decision-making processes and ensure their pragmatic implementation. • You systematically translate governance requirements into processes and tools. In doing so, you ensure that these are operationalized step by step and optimally integrated into our everyday work. • You develop key figures and maturity models to make the effectiveness of data governance measurable. • As a bridge builder, you promote a common understanding of data governance in the company and enable our employees to manage and use data in a value-adding and trustworthy manner. • In doing so, you work closely with the relevant Data Management & Governance stakeholders, especially with Data Owners, Data Stewards, Data Custodians, as well as the departments of Architecture, Data Protection, Compliance, Information Security, and the affected specialist and ART stakeholders. What you bring with you ## • Most important first: You have at least 10 years of experience in the areas of Data Governance, Data Management, or Information Management. You have developed Data Governance frameworks and successfully anchored them in the company. • With your conceptual strength, your diplomatic skill, and your coaching skills, you succeed in winning a wide variety of stakeholders for a common governance logic and taking our employees along on the journey. • You know how governance requirements can be translated into effective processes, controls, and tooling and create the prerequisite for step-by-step operationalization and (partial) automation. • You also bring knowledge of DAMA-DMBOK or comparable frameworks as well as experience in successfully operationalizing data governance in a regulated environment. • A degree in Information Science, Business Informatics, Data Management, or a comparable discipline forms your foundation - whether classical or via detours, we are open to your individual career path. • You communicate confidently and appropriately for the target group in German and English and also bring complex topics to the point in an understandable way.
